Applications are invited for the position of Electorate Officer in the Office of Eleni Petinos MP, Member for Miranda and Shadow Minister for Finance and Shadow Minister for Sport.
The Miranda Electorate Office is the point of contact for constituents and local community groups to engage with the Member for Miranda regarding state government services and responsibilities.
The role would suit a highly motivated person who is able to work independently with a capacity to respond in a timely manner to changing circumstances.
**About the position**
- Managing constituent correspondence within the office, regularly assisting residents with queries both in person and online and assisting, organising and attending (with the Member) community engagement activities and events.
- Liaising with government, community and portfolio stakeholders.
- Undertake research and assist with portfolio work as it relates to the shadow finance and sport portfolios including the drafting of policy speeches, briefing notes and information packs.
- Speech writing including questions on notice, notices of motion, community recognition statements and private members’ statements.
- Drafting media releases and talking points for community and portfolio events.
- Providing short, medium and long-term strategic advice to the Member about a wide range of issues.
The role requires after hours work for which an annual All Incidence of Employment Allowance is paid.
